BREAKING NEWS: Hesperus Masonic Lodge #837 has just announced a generous donation of $25,648 to Crossroads House, a vital community resource in Bergen. This significant contribution was raised during the 25th Annual Van Hulburt Memorial Golf Tournament, highlighting the lodge’s commitment to supporting local initiatives.
The donation, confirmed earlier today, aims to bolster the services provided by Crossroads House, which offers shelter and support for individuals in need. This financial boost comes at a critical time, underscoring the lodge’s dedication to making a tangible difference in the community.
“This contribution will significantly enhance our ability to serve those in need,” said a representative from Crossroads House. The lodge’s efforts, fueled by the success of their annual golf tournament, demonstrate the power of community engagement in addressing urgent social issues.
The Van Hulburt Memorial Golf Tournament has become a staple event in Bergen, attracting participants and sponsors who are passionate about philanthropy. This year’s event not only celebrated athleticism but also showcased the generosity of local businesses and residents.
